WHITBY FREE PRESS, WEDNESDAY, 1-7-EBRUARY 25, 1976, PAGE 15' Fire& recreation departments presentingcarnival'next week Next week for the first j <tne 1i four years Whitby i'eaturing skating dernonstra- lions hockey and broomn bal gaines and lots more. The Whitby Fire Depart- ment and the toWn recreation departmnent have teamied Up to co-ordinate the carnival at the Iroquois Park Arena, March 4 to 7, in celebration of the fire department's I 25th Sanniversary. I The events get under way at 8 p.m. March 4 with the regular Whtby Warriors hockey game plus a few other special attractions. Special rates will be charged for high sehool students that niglit and there wilI be the crowning of a Carnival Queen and two princesses, selected from- the town 's high schools. Three girls fromn each of the town's three high schools an d the Ontario Ladies' College will be competing for the honor, and the queen will be crowned by Mayor Jim Gartshiore at the carnival's opening ceremonies between the second and third periods of the hockey game. The opening ceremonies will be at 9:30 p.m. On Friday, March 5 there will b e a variety of school hockey and broombail games, starting at 5 p.m. with King Street Sehool playing Palmer- ston. At 6 p.m. there will be 'a girls' broombali game between Ontario Ladies' College and Anderson Collegiate, follow- ed at 6:45 p.m. by a broom- :b6all gamne between Henry Street High School and Denis 0O'Connor. At 7:35 p.m. the Whitby Figure Skating Club will put -on an hour-long demonstra- tion. followed by a hockey -garne between Henry- ànci Anderson Highi Schools. Saturday, Mardi 6 froni 10 a.m. to noon there wilI be skate races for public schiool grades one to eight, followed by hockey garnes between Hutchison and St. Paul's Schools and Meadowcrest and West Lynde schools. At 2:15 p.m. there wilI be a girls' Ringette gaine, followed by more high school hockey and broombail games, throughout the afternoon. At 8 p.mi. there wilI be a gamne by the Brooklin- Whitby Minor Hockey Association. The game schedule of broombali and hockey wilI begin again at 1: 15 p.rn. Sunday March 7, followed by final skate-races at Sp.l.- In the evening there will be the finals of the public and higli school hockey and girls' broombal1 games. 'Admission to the winter carnival events wilI be 50 cents for aduits and 25 cents for children. Deputy Recreation Direc- tor Fred Beckette and Fire Chief Ed Crouchi are the co-ordinators of the winterl c'arnival, the first to be held ini the Iroquois Park Arena. Both were involved in the winter carnivals held in the old Wlhitby ameia in 1971 and 1972. MERCANTILE ITBY PLAZA DEPT, IREADERISHIP 1SURtV.E.Y In an effort to determine what our readers 3.
